Global Trade Week – Virtual Exhibition Seeks to Reconnect Businesses to Reach Buyers and Suppliers

MIE Groups, including its Kenya subsidiary Global Exhibitions Inc. will stage its first B2B Virtual Exhibition platform, Global Trade Week Virtual Exhibition (GTW VE).

GTW VE aims to allow adversely affected businesses in continental Africa to access the global market, as well as reach out to a broad network of buyers and suppliers to bolster their business offerings.

The COVID-19 pandemic has negatively affected all facets of business for organizations operating in the region and the world beyond. The pandemic has also seen the cancellation of tens of trade shows. Others have been pushed forward in the hope that things will be better.

The entire disarray has had a $16.2 billion impact on the global economy so far. To this end, GTW VW seeks to be part of the solution; it is an innovation with the MIE Group that looks forward to reconnecting businesses all over the globe by creating a virtual business environment that will stop the downturn in the marketplace. The platform will meet this goal by allowing businesses to run their operation normally, and mainly targets small and medium enterprises.

How GTW VE works

Visitors can register online to get connected to the GTW-VE universe. Afterward, they can look for products and services before connecting with a seller for additional engagement. Further, they can detail their project proposals before submitting RFQ’s and engaging with qualified suppliers. Lastly, they can have a one-on-one meeting to discuss additional business requirements.

Exhibitors, on the other hand, can register online to connect with GTW-VE team members. They can then book a stand to get connected to the GTW-VE universe.

Exhibitors are also required to upload and display their product and company information. They are also required to activate some sponsorship and advertising platforms to push engagements. The rest of the steps is the same for visitors where 1-1 engagements are pursued to make a sale.

Handling logistics

GTW-VE reports that it has robust assistance from its Global Logistics Partner DB SCHENKER. The partner will offer free customs clearance for any clients using its logistics chains, a 10% refund on overall logistics, special warehousing and dedicated account management.

Perks of attending GTW-VE

Attendees will have the opportunity to connect with global manufacturers and suppliers, as well as view the most recent innovative products at an exclusive virtual exhibition environment.

Attendees have also been promised ease of registration and access, real-time live chat, and 1-1 video between visitors and exhibitors.

Furthermore, they have a platform to build a global personal network, with built-in e-commerce for real-time business transactions.

Beyond business, the platform will also drive thought leadership through its dedicated virtual conferences, live keynote presentations, moderated panel discussions, and exclusive webinars.

Perks of exhibiting

Participants are encouraged to exhibit because they can develop new revenue streams because if a given live event was postponed, then the affected business can use the platform to keep business running through attendee registrations, sponsorships, and networking.

Reportedly, the platform is also easy to manage and navigate because it has been designed with simplicity to transfer a business virtually.

Additional perks include an automated process-driven environment, and a competitive advantage at a fraction of investment because there is no travel, accommodation or shipment.

The first Zhejiang Jiaxing Haiyan Online Export Trade Fair was held on GTW (June 9 – 13) where 50 exhibitors showcased their products and services.

The platform is also seeking opportunities for SMEs through digital exhibitions. It is planning to unveil matching meetings, sub-forums, and other accessory events to appeal to more SMEs.
